Engineering Considerations for 3D Printing & CNC Equipment

Modern CNC machine
Precision & Step Resolution

Stepper and micro-stepping systems must match the desired print resolution or machining accuracy to prevent layer shifts or contour errors.

Torque Stability at Low Speeds

Extruders and Z-axis lifts need motors that maintain torque during slow, controlled movements.

Heat Management & Duty Cycle

Continuous printing and machining require motors that stay efficient and cool during long operating periods.

Gearbox Selection & Backlash Control

Planetary or low-backlash gear systems improve accuracy for precision axes, tool changers, and slow-speed mechanical movements.

Noise & Vibration Suppression

Reduced vibration improves print quality and surface finish, making motor stability essential.

Compact Integration & Mounting Compatibility

Motors must fit into tight frames while offering stable mounting for multi-axis systems.
